/**
 * Class to verify that {@link Constants#STORAGE_CLASS} is set correctly
 * for creating and renaming huge files with multipart upload requests.
 */
public class ITestS3AHugeFilesStorageClass extends AbstractSTestS3AHugeFiles {

  private static final Logger LOG = LoggerFactory.getLogger(ITestS3AHugeFilesStorageClass.class);

  @Override
  protected Configuration createScaleConfiguration() {
    Configuration conf = super.createScaleConfiguration();
    skipIfStorageClassTestsDisabled(conf);
    disableFilesystemCaching(conf);
    removeBaseAndBucketOverrides(conf, STORAGE_CLASS);

    conf.set(STORAGE_CLASS, STORAGE_CLASS_REDUCED_REDUNDANCY);
    return conf;
  }

  @Override
  protected String getBlockOutputBufferName() {
    return Constants.FAST_UPLOAD_BUFFER_ARRAY;
  }

  @Override
  public void test_010_CreateHugeFile() throws IOException {
    super.test_010_CreateHugeFile();
    assertStorageClass(getPathOfFileToCreate());
  }

  @Override
  public void test_030_postCreationAssertions() throws Throwable {
    super.test_030_postCreationAssertions();
    assertStorageClass(getPathOfFileToCreate());
  }

  @Override
  public void test_040_PositionedReadHugeFile() throws Throwable {
    skipQuietly("PositionedReadHugeFile");
  }

  @Override
  public void test_050_readHugeFile() throws Throwable {
    skipQuietly("readHugeFile");
  }

  @Override
  public void test_090_verifyRenameSourceEncryption() throws IOException {
    skipQuietly("verifyRenameSourceEncryption");
  }

  @Override
  public void test_100_renameHugeFile() throws Throwable {
    Path hugefile = getHugefile();
    Path hugefileRenamed = getHugefileRenamed();
    assumeHugeFileExists();
    describe("renaming %s to %s", hugefile, hugefileRenamed);
    S3AFileSystem fs = getFileSystem();
    FileStatus status = fs.getFileStatus(hugefile);
    long size = status.getLen();
    fs.delete(hugefileRenamed, false);
    ContractTestUtils.NanoTimer timer = new ContractTestUtils.NanoTimer();
    fs.rename(hugefile, hugefileRenamed);
    long mb = Math.max(size / _1MB, 1);
    timer.end("time to rename file of %d MB", mb);
    LOG.info("Time per MB to rename = {} nS", toHuman(timer.nanosPerOperation(mb)));
    bandwidth(timer, size);
    FileStatus destFileStatus = fs.getFileStatus(hugefileRenamed);
    assertEquals(size, destFileStatus.getLen());
    assertStorageClass(hugefileRenamed);
  }

  @Override
  public void test_110_verifyRenameDestEncryption() throws IOException {
    skipQuietly("verifyRenameDestEncryption");
  }

  private void skipQuietly(String text) {
    describe("Skipping: %s", text);
  }

  protected void assertStorageClass(Path hugeFile) throws IOException {

    String actual = getS3AInternals().getObjectMetadata(hugeFile).storageClassAsString();

    assertTrue(
        "Storage class of object is " + actual + ", expected " + STORAGE_CLASS_REDUCED_REDUNDANCY,
        STORAGE_CLASS_REDUCED_REDUNDANCY.equalsIgnoreCase(actual));
  }
}
